Computes the Legendre elliptic integral of the second kind. You must manually select the polymorphic instance you want to use.

Complete Elliptic Integral E
The following equation defines the complete elliptic integral of the second kind.
where k is the square of the elliptic modulus.
Incomplete Elliptic Integral E
The following equation defines the incomplete elliptic integral of the second kind.
where k is the square of the elliptic modulus and a is the upper limit, or amplitude, of the integral.
The following intervals for the input values define the function.
LabVIEW supports the entire domain of this function that produces real-valued results. For any real value of upper limit a, the function is defined for all real values of k in the unit interval.
